Abstract :
The aim of this paper is to present a transient stability index which can be used for on-line security assessment of power systems by providing a measure for their level of security. This index is constructed applying a computational technique described in the paper and based on the principles of the pattern recognition and fuzzy sets theory. The results that can be obtained from the application of the developed index in the transient stability evaluation of power systems are illustrated by the analysis of a sample transmission system.
